KB Financial Group Inc. is a financial holding company in Korea. The company operations include Kookmin Bank, one of the commercial banks in Korea. The company's subsidiaries collectively engage in a broad range of businesses, including commercial banking, credit cards, asset management, non-life and life insurance, capital markets activities, and international banking and finance. The company's segments include the Banking business, Securities business, Non-life Insurance business, Credit card business, and Life Insurance business. The Group generates the majority of its revenue from the Banking business.
EQT is an independent natural gas production company. It focuses its operations in the cores of the Marcellus and Utica shales, located in the Appalachian Basin in the Eastern United States. Its main customers include marketers, utilities, and industrial operators in the Appalachian Basin. The company has three reportable segments in production, gathering, and its transmission segment, which is now an operated joint venture with Blackstone. All the firm's operating revenue is generated in the US, with most revenue flowing from the Marcellus Shale field and through the sale of natural gas.
